What are some typical challenges faced when developing software for embedded RTOS environments?

Developing software for embedded RTOS (Real-Time Operating System) environments often involves unique challenges such as managing limited memory and processing resources, ensuring deterministic real-time performance, and debugging in resource-constrained systems. Team members frequently collaborate closely with hardware engineers to optimize code for specific microcontrollers or processors. Additionally, balancing task prioritization and inter-task communication to avoid deadlocks or priority inversion is a common focus. These complexities make strong problem-solving skills and attention to detail particularly valuable in this role.

What is an embedded RTOS?

An Embedded RTOS (Real-Time Operating System) is a specialized operating system designed to manage hardware resources and run applications with precise timing requirements in embedded systems. Unlike general-purpose operating systems, an RTOS ensures that tasks are executed predictably and meet strict deadlines, which is crucial in applications like automotive systems, medical devices, and industrial automation. Embedded RTOSs provide features like multitasking, task scheduling, and inter-task communication, all optimized for resource-constrained environments. They help developers create reliable, efficient, and responsive embedded applications.

Job Description

This is a hands-on technical leadership role. While the title includes "software," the work is primarily embedded and firmware-focused: RTOS-based systems, hardware bring-up, driver development, board-level debugging, and close collaboration with electrical and mechanical teams. Some upper-stack or tooling work exists, but the core responsibility is commanding and controlling hardware.ย 

The Technical Lead owns embedded software at both the tactical and strategic levels, ensuring that systems are architected correctly, risks are identified early, and the broader team is unblocked when challenges arise. This role sets technical direction, streamlines and documents software processes, establishes best practices, and raises the embedded engineering bar across projects.ย
